Output 70df134f581caa53f379f23add1a942af214dcae95968ef1b05690a975de6388:4

value
588166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f666174a20dc6db69afed9befc1717252b68c3b OP_EQUAL
address
MKWnhKwgtgKkrZpm8LLSTegCFcUQhmTqHD
transaction
70df134f581caa53f379f23add1a942af214dcae95968ef1b05690a975de6388
spent
true